Look at Area Research (CPR) recently analyzed numerous common relationships software with over ten million packages joint to help you know the way secure he could be having users. Once the relationship apps usually use geolocation study, offering the possibility to apply at somebody regional, that it benefits ability commonly happens at a price. Our very own look focuses primarily on a specific application titled Hornet which had vulnerabilities, enabling the specific located area of the associate, and therefore gifts a primary privacy exposure so you’re able to the profiles.
Key Results
- Processes particularly trilateration allow burglars to choose affiliate coordinates playing with distance pointers
- Despite safety measures, the new Hornet relationships app a famous gay relationships application with over ten billion downloads had weaknesses, allowing precise location dedication, no matter if profiles disabled brand new display screen of their distances. We establish a strategy one greeting us to go venue precision contained in this ten m during the reproducible experiments
- The brand new Hornet builders have observed the tips to reduce potential risks, with led to a reduction in area precision so you can 50 meters.
Assessment
CPR discovered that the latest Hornet application sends exact coordinates into servers. Hornet’s creators know the potential risks from affiliate position, as previously mentioned on their site. Nonetheless, they do say to guard associate urban centers because of the randomizing the length displayed regarding app, therefore it is, within view, impractical to determine the particular venue. Although not, this is simply not the case.
At the time of our very own browse, the new procedures drawn of the Hornet were lack of to safeguard user coordinates, making it possible for the fresh new devotion out of representative metropolitan areas with quite high accuracy.
Adopting the in charge disclosure process, we made an effort to get in touch with the new Hornet team, going for the outcomes of our own lookup. In advance of which guide, i reexamined new Hornet software. Even with not getting a reaction to our very own inquiry, View Part Lookup can be concur that the designers have already then followed needed steps to help you somewhat reduce the precision of users’ coordinate determination. As the specified in control revelation due dates enjoys enacted, we’re publishing the outcomes of one’s look.
Insights Geolocation & You’ll Risks:
Geolocation are an experience that uses analysis obtained away from your measuring equipment (like a smartphone, pill, or notebook) to spot or estimate the true-community geographic area of that unit. This article vary of really precise venue information (including a particular target or place coordinates) derived compliment of GPS (Global positioning system unit) so you’re able to faster specific area research received thru Ip, Wi-Fi, cellular networking sites, otherwise Bluetooth beacons.
Geolocation tech, while you are beneficial, gift ideas multiple dangers, particularly when it comes to privacy and you may safeguards in this apps. They’ve been prospective privacy breaches regarding unauthorized research availability, unintended discussing out-of area study that have third-people entities, risks of tracking and you can monitoring, and you may security weaknesses such as for example venue spoofing. This particular article might possibly be taken advantage of of the stalkers, burglars, or other malicious actors.
Strategy to own determining range
From inside the Hornet and you may similar software, users regarding the search engine results was sorted inside rising acquisition of length. Whenever we get a hold of two users throughout the google search results who enable it to be the monitor of the distance, together with target associate is found among them about browse efficiency, we could influence the fresh new calculate range toward address member given that the common worth of several recognized distances:
However, the existence of pages near the target is not an important condition. To select the point towards the representative, it is needed to check in a supplementary account, the coordinates where is going to be regulated.
You could potentially dictate the length between a couple users of the iteratively breaking up the range in two and you can position an additional membership on midpoint. From the checking out the brand new search engine results and you will polishing the brand new browse centered on the clear presence of the target affiliate, progressively narrowing down the range involving the target as well as the more membership, we can reach the wished reliability.
Trilateration methodology
We put a couple of-step trilateration: basic, we performed trilateration having fun with a couple of resource items to see a couple possible candidate urban centers (intersection points of sectors). After that, we made use of the point suggestions about 3rd site point out select the proper service.
Making the assumption that we all know the room where target account is, with an effective diameter from ten km. Such as for example, this could be a small area. For this city, we at random produced 31 categories of reference products inside the a ring that have an interior radius of five kilometer and an exterior radius from 10 kilometer.
Down to trilateration each number of resource things, we acquired a set of you can easily coordinates on address point. The maximum error inside the geolocation are 350 yards, and also the lowest was just 2 m. I computed the new imply property value latitude and you may longitude for everyone circumstances. The distance amongst the imply worthy of and the target part seemed are 24 meters.
Boosting geolocation precision
Having the ability to dictate the new approximate venue, i made reference issues at a distance of just one to 2 kilometers inside the area where the address was supposed to be located. Implementing all of our method, i gotten of numerous rates of your target place. This new geolocation errors have been delivered nearly equally, of at least 1.5 m and you will a total of 70 yards. I and determined the typical latitude and you will longitude on the show. The new resulting mediocre part try less than 5 yards off the mark part:
Conclusion
With respect to relationships apps, adding user geolocation presents high threats so you’re able to privacy. Our studies revealed possible weaknesses about Hornet dating application, that has more ten mil downloads. The brand new created distance estimation strategy, along with trilateration playing with many source products, shown a really high precision into the deciding associate towns.
Hornet developers applied alter so you’re able to decrease the dangers, decreasing the area reliability to help you fifty meters. So it update, while you are extreme, however lets a motivated assailant to determine approximate coordinates.
CPR strongly advises pages to be vigilant in regards to the permissions they grant so you can apps and also to stand informed towards perils and greatest techniques to own protecting confidentiality and you may safety whenever dealing with geolocation analysis. By disabling venue attributes, profiles can possibly prevent apps of record their whereabouts and you can get together recommendations regarding their actions. It level can be effectively protect user privacy and you can circumvent the fresh revealing off private information which have exterior entities.